LogoMovies Logo
On The Job: Cancer Crackdown

On The Job: Cancer Crackdown

While discovering the cure for cancer, Dr. Castle (Jenna Castle) has an unexpected delivery.

Other Streaming Options

Buy

Buy
Not available

Rent

Rent
Not available